  5. mvalenti

    Carb rack screws

    FYI, button heads have a shallower socket as compared to socket heads. As something your probably going to open and clean a few times in the bikes life you might want to go with socket head style.

  19. mvalenti

    What happened here?

    it may not be a short, it could be a bad connection that builds up heat over time due to the increasing resistance. I have had stranded wire that corroded to the point where only 1/2 of the strands were carrying the current and yes, they got hot.
